drm: sde: Remove feature support for IGC/3D LUT for virtual planes
Attempts by virtual planes to set IGC and 3D LUT values are unsupported and will result in LUTDMA hangs. Update virtual DRM planes capabilities to disallow these features and make any attempts to set them a NOP.
